Advanced Micro Devices Inc. — frequently asked questions

What does Advanced Micro Devices Inc. do?

Advanced Micro Devices Inc. operates as a semiconductor company worldwide. It operates through Data Center, Client, Gaming, and Embedded segments. Advanced Micro Devices Inc. operates in the Technology sector and trades on the NASDAQ under the ticker AMD.

Which stock exchange is AMD listed on?

Advanced Micro Devices Inc. is listed on the NASDAQ, where it trades under the ticker symbol AMD. It is classified in the Technology sector.
